EMILE-ANTOINE BOURDELLE (1861-1929). The fright. Bas-relief in plaster, signed lower left, dedicated "to the poet Guy Hollande, amicably", lower left. 48 x 40 x 12 cm. Misses. PROVENANCE. This work was given to Guy Hollande, doctor, poet, by Émile-Antoine Bourdelle. Guy Hollande died in 1926. After his wife's death in 1953, the work entered the family, a friend of the Hollande family, where it has been kept until today. There is a letter from Guy Hollande to Bourdelle dated 1906 in the Bourdelle Museum in Paris.
